Proposal Pool Administration: Complex Worklists 
Purpose
You can create a complex worklist in
Proposal Pool Administration to generate a list of entries from the proposal pool which satisfy complex criteria.You can create worklists for the following Purposes:
A CCASE worklist provides you with entries where the same source text occurs in different forms with regard to capitalization and is, however, translated differently.

A CMARK worklist provides you with entries where the source text is both the target text of another language combination available in the system and is flagged for automatic distribution for that language combination.

A CLVAR worklist helps you to identify target texts which may have been incorrectly assigned as length variants (because they are not in fact a shortened version or upper/lowercase variant of the node text, but instead a different translation).

Prerequisites
To create and schedule a worklist in Proposal Pool Administration, you need to have Advanced
translator status (value 3) for proposal pool maintenance assigned to you in your translator profile.Process Flow
Result
As soon as your worklist has active status, you can begin editing the entries contained in the worklist (in the same way you edit a list of entries in STMP) by choosing Edit WL (STMP) under WL Administration.
